Jaeger Instrumentation- 15-Inch Steel WheelsEquipped with a 1,991cc
inline-four engine paired with a 4-speed manual transmission and
dual SU carburetors fitted with mesh-style pancake air cleaners.
One of the TR3's most significant achievements was becoming one of
the first production sports cars to feature front disc brakes, a
major advancement in braking performance that helped influence
sports car design throughout the late 1950s.Additional equipment
